rgmanager and clustat not display cluster services


Hi

Does anyone know the reason I cannot see any services in my clustat output

eg:
clustat
Timed out waiting for a response from Resource Group Manager
Member Status: Quorate

Member Name Status
------ ---- ------
xxxxx01 Online
xxxxx02 Online, Local, rgmanager
xxxxx1 Online, rgmanager
xxxxx2 Online, rgmanager

I am using a 4 node cluster and when I run the clustat command I get a timeout waiting for a response from Resource Group Manager.

I used to be able to see services running on any node . I think there may be a problem with rgmanager however it is running on all nodes.
Does anyone have any idea how I can diagnose this problem ? Why is rgmanager now on the fist node even though it is running.

Any help appreciated
